首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

日期类型为null的SQL Server 2016 Convert函数与SQL Server 2008 R2不同

在SQL Server 2016中,日期类型为null的Convert函数与SQL Server 2008 R2有所不同。在SQL Server 2016中,当日期类型为null时,Convert函数会返回null值,而在SQL Server 2008 R2中,Convert函数会返回一个默认的日期值。

这种差异可能会对应用程序的行为产生影响。在SQL Server 2016中,如果应用程序依赖于Convert函数返回默认日期值的行为,那么在迁移到SQL Server 2016时,需要对应用程序进行相应的修改。

以下是SQL Server 2016中Convert函数的使用示例:

代码语言:txt
复制
-- 将日期类型为null的字段转换为字符串类型
SELECT CONVERT(VARCHAR, NULL) AS ConvertedValue;

在上述示例中,Convert函数将日期类型为null的字段转换为字符串类型,并返回null值。

对于日期类型为null的处理,可以根据具体的业务需求来决定如何处理。在某些情况下,可以使用ISNULL函数或COALESCE函数来将null值转换为其他默认值。

腾讯云提供了一系列与SQL Server相关的云产品,包括云数据库SQL Server版、云数据库TDSQL、云数据库CynosDB等。这些产品提供了高可用性、高性能、灵活扩展等特性,适用于各种规模的应用场景。您可以通过以下链接了解更多关于腾讯云SQL Server产品的信息:

请注意,以上链接仅供参考,具体选择适合的产品需要根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券